Kerry Retail Forum to take place online this Thursday
This Thursday the Kerry Retail Forum takes place online.
Starting at 9am, the public is are invited to attend a short online webinar focused specifically on Supporting Retail in Kerry.
Kerry Retail Forum want to hear from retailers, and get their input into a number of key ideas and initiatives, including:
- ShopKerry.ie: A shared e-commerce platform for all Kerry retailers
- Trading Online Vouchers: Maximising your Online Presence
- The Kerry Gift Card
- Open For Business: Safe Destination Training supports.”
The webinar is being hosted by The Kerry Chambers, Kerry County Council and Kerry Local Enterprise Office - All who want input from Retail Business Owners in Kerry.
